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about preschools in Bippus, IN:

What types of preschool programs are available in Bippus, Indiana?

In Bippus and the surrounding Huntington County area, you'll typically find home-based preschools, faith-based programs often affiliated with local churches, and potentially part-day options through community centers. Due to the rural nature of the area, many families also consider preschools in nearby larger towns like Huntington. It's important to visit and understand each program's educational philosophy, whether play-based, academic, or a hybrid.

How much does preschool typically cost in Bippus, IN?

Costs can vary significantly. Home-based or church-affiliated preschools in the Bippus area may range from $100 to $200 per month for part-time programs. Indiana state programs like On My Way Pre-K provide free preschool for qualifying 4-year-olds, but availability depends on approved providers in the county. Always inquire about registration fees, supply costs, and whether snacks are included.

What should I look for regarding licensing and safety in a Bippus preschool?

Ensure any preschool is licensed by the Indiana Family and Social Services Administration (FSSA), which sets health, safety, and staff training standards. You can verify a provider's license online. For home-based programs, ask about their emergency plans for rural locations and staff-to-child ratios. A safe, clean environment with clear pickup/dropoff procedures is essential.

When and how do I enroll my child in a preschool in Bippus?

Enrollment timelines vary, but many programs in this community begin registration in early spring (February/March) for the fall semester. Popular local programs can fill quickly, so it's advisable to start contacting providers by January. You'll typically need a completed enrollment form, a copy of your child's immunization records, and a birth certificate.

Are there any unique considerations for choosing a preschool in a small town like Bippus?

Yes, transportation is a key factor, as most preschools in small towns do not provide bus service, so parents must arrange drop-off and pickup. Also, consider the program's schedule alignment with the local elementary school (typically Huntington County Community School Corporation) for smoother future transitions. Building a relationship with a local provider can offer a strong, community-oriented foundation for your child.

Finding Your Child's First Classroom: A Guide to Affordable Preschool in Bippus

As a parent in our close-knit Bippus community, you know the value of a strong start. The early years are a precious time of growth, and finding the right preschool environment that nurtures your child’s curiosity without straining the family budget is a common concern. The search for an "affordable preschool near me" is about more than just cost; it’s about discovering a place where your little one can thrive, make friends, and build the foundational skills for a lifetime of learning, all within the fabric of our local area.

First, it’s important to define what "affordable" means in the context of early childhood education here in Huntington County. Affordability isn't just about the lowest tuition; it's about the value received for your investment. A quality affordable preschool will offer a structured yet playful curriculum, caring and qualified teachers, a safe and stimulating environment, and a schedule that works for working families. In Bippus and the surrounding towns, you’ll find that many programs understand the financial realities of rural and small-town living and strive to create accessible options.

Your search should begin close to home. Don't overlook the wonderful programs offered through our local churches and community centers. These are often pillars of affordability and provide a warm, familiar setting for children’s first school experience. Many operate as non-profits with a mission to serve families, which can translate to very reasonable rates. It’s always worth a visit to see if their educational philosophy and classroom atmosphere feel like a good fit for your child’s personality.

Another key step is to inquire directly about financial flexibility. When you call or visit a preschool, ask clear questions. Do they offer sliding scale tuition based on income? Are there sibling discounts for families with more than one child enrolled? Some programs may have scholarship funds or can guide you toward state assistance programs like Indiana’s On My Way Pre-K, which provides vouchers for eligible four-year-olds to attend high-quality preschools. Being proactive in these conversations can open doors you might not have known were there.

Finally, remember that the best measure of a preschool’s value is your own observation. Schedule a time to visit. Watch how the teachers interact with the children—are they engaged and patient? Look at the space—is it clean, organized, and filled with books and creative materials? Talk to the director about a typical day. You want to see a balance of guided learning, free play, social interaction, and rest.
